Projects arent loading under "Project" Dropdown

Kyle Carrizales August 25, 2017

I have a user, that creates a project, and is an admin of the software. When he creates the project, it doesnt populate under the "Projects" dropdown menu. Now I made sure that the project was under the correct permission scheme. I also created a new permission scheme and opened the permissions up for anyone to access, and the user still cannot see the project. I can , however.

Kyle,

just to be sure here...when you say the project doesn't appear under the Projects drop down menu, do you mean the user cannot find if they go to Projects>View all projects? The list of projects represent recent projects visited so if they never went to the project it would not show. I expect this isn't the problem you are seeing but just wanted to check.
